  • Version Remarks
    This Order, encrusted with gemstones (diamonds, and other gems), was reserved for heads of states, distinguished nobleman, and highest clergy. As a rule each piece is unique, with size and variety of gemstones varying greatly. Extremely rare award. Value depends on the period and quality of manufacture, size, maker, metal/gemstones composition, provenance. Austrian makers produced the finest examples. Today, most are in museums.

History


This Order was founded by the Duke of Austria, Philip III the Good, in commemoration of his marriage to Isabella of Portugal.

The Knights of the Order were responsible for defending the Roman Catholic religion, upholding chivalry, and aiding the Sovereign during war.

The Knights were appointed by the Sovereign Head of the Order. While there was no limit to the number of permitted Knights, membership was restricted to aristocratic Catholic gentlemen.

This Order was considered one of the most prestigious European Orders.
